Novel Treatment Option for Neuropathic Pain

NCT02490436 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 15

Last updated 2016-11-08

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ine whether the EGFR-inhibitor cetuximab is better than placebo for the treatment of neuropathic pain.

Conditions

  • Neuralgia
  • Complex Regional Pain Syndromes

Interventions

DRUG

Cetuximab

Randomized cross-over between cetuximab and placebo

DRUG

Placebo

Randomized cross-over between cetuximab and placebo
